Treacle Tart

  • Prep: 1 hr.
  • Cook: 30 mins
  • Ready in: 1 hr., 30 mins
  • Serves:

Ingredients

  • 1.5 cups plain (all-purpose) flour
  • 2 tsp caster (superfine) sugar
  • 3 oz butter or margarine
  • 1 egg yolk
  • 8 oz golden (light corn) syrup
  • 1 cup fresh breadcrumbs
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• Cream, Custard Sauce or ice cream to serve

Cooking Instructions

Mix together the flour and sugar and rub in the butter or margarine until the mixture resembles coarse breadcrumbs.

Mix to a firm pastry (paste) with the egg yolk, wrap in clingfilm (plastic wrap) and chill for 30 minutes.

Roll out on a lightly floured surface and to line a greased 20 cm/8 in pie dish.

Warm the syrup, then stir in the breadcrumbs and lemon juice and leave to cool.

Pour into the pastry base and bake in a preheated oven at 180°C/350°F/gas mark 4 for 35 minutes until set and golden.

Serve hot or cold with cream, Custard Sauce or ice cream.
